Rigidity noun - The quality or state of being demanding or unyielding (as in discipline or criticism).
Usage example: sometimes the rigidity of the headmaster's discipline was deemed excessive by even much of the faculty
Firmness is a synonym for rigidity in hardness topic. You can use "Firmness" instead a noun "Rigidity", if it concerns topics such as stiffness.
